A Link Function Specification Test in the Single Functional Index Model

Kwo Lik Chan;Aldo Goia
2023-01-01

Abstract

In this paper a test for specification in functional regression with scalar response that exploits semi-parametric principles is illustrated. Once the test statistics is defined, its asymptotic null distribution is derived under suitable conditions. The finite sample performances of the test are analyzed through a simulation study by using both the asymptotic p-value and some bootstrap approaches. To appreciate the potentialities of the method, an application to a spectrometric real dataset is performed.
